Sending a Mail and Visitation
The Litchfield City Jail does not allow its inmates to receive or send mails or packages and prohibits any of its arrestees from getting visitors. If you wish to visit or send correspondence to the inmate, you will have to wait until they transfer to a Montgomery County, Illinois Sheriff’s Office jail.Visiting Hours
